Finding Deals and Selling Your Stuff in II Brownwood
Alright, let's get down to business: how do you actually use these iibrownwood newspaper classifieds to your advantage, whether you're hunting for bargains or trying to offload some of your own stuff? First off, when you're buying, the key is consistency. Don't just check the classifieds once; make it a habit, maybe every time the paper comes out. You never know when that perfect item – that vintage lamp you’ve been searching for, a reliable used car, or even a unique piece of local art – might pop up. When you find something you're interested in, don't hesitate to call the number listed. Be polite, ask clear questions about the item's condition, its history, and why they're selling it. Sometimes, you can even negotiate the price a bit, especially if you’re picking it up in person. Remember, these are often private sellers, not big retailers, so there’s room for friendly haggling. For those looking to sell, placing an effective ad is crucial. Start with a clear and concise headline that grabs attention. Instead of just "Table for Sale," try "Solid Oak Dining Table - Great Condition!" or "Kids' Bike - Like New!" This immediately tells potential buyers what you’re offering. In the body of your ad, be honest about the item’s condition. Mention any flaws, but also highlight its best features. Use descriptive words! Is it "vintage," "antique," "modern," "energy-efficient," "hand-crafted"? The more detail you provide, the better you can attract serious buyers and avoid unnecessary inquiries. Include your contact information clearly, and specify if you prefer calls or texts. If you’re selling something large, like furniture or appliances, it’s always a good idea to mention if you can help with delivery or if the buyer will need to arrange pickup. This saves everyone time and potential hassle. The goal is to make your item stand out in the sea of other listings. Think about what would make you call about an ad. Often, it's a combination of a good deal and clear, trustworthy information. The key to making your classified ad work for your business is to be clear, concise, and compelling. Your headline needs to shout out your unique selling proposition. Are you the "Fastest Oil Change in Brownwood"? Or perhaps the "Best Coffee & Pastries - Baked Fresh Daily!" Use strong action verbs and highlight benefits. Instead of just listing services, explain how you solve a customer's problem. For a plumber, it might be "24/7 Emergency Plumbing - No Job Too Small!" For a landscaper, "Transform Your Yard - Affordable & Reliable Service!" Include your business name, phone number, website (if applicable), and maybe even a special offer exclusive to newspaper readers – like "Mention this ad for 10% off!" This not only drives traffic but also helps you track the effectiveness of your ad. The cost-effectiveness of newspaper classifieds is another huge plus for small businesses.
